Ask HN: Admittedly Useless Side Projects?
Not exactly useless but I haven't updated it for a long time. The project is called react-qml[0]. Basically it allows you to develop Desktop application using modern JavaScript/TypeScript and/or Qt/QML.
This project helped one of my consulting client 5x their development velocity.
